GEA Group has an employee rating of 3.7 out of 5 stars, based on 598 company reviews on Glassdoor which indicates that most employees have a good working experience there. The GEA Group employee rating is in line with the average (within 1 standard deviation) for employers within the Manufacturing industry (3.5 stars).
